Ventilatory capacity and risk for dementia.

Summary
Reduced lung function, measured by spirometry, is linked to a higher risk of dementia in older adults. This suggests poor respiratory health may independently increase dementia risk.

Background:
- Previous research linked ventilatory capacity indicators to cognitive function but not specifically dementia.
- This study investigates the association between various ventilatory capacity measures and dementia in the elderly.
Purpose of the Study:
- To examine the relationship between different spirometry-derived ventilatory capacity indicators and dementia.
- To control for significant confounding factors in this relationship.
Main Methods:
- Analysis of cross-sectional data from 437 participants (aged 70+) in the Berlin Aging Study (BASE).
- Ventilatory capacity assessed via spirometry: peak expiratory flow rate (PEF-R), forced expiratory volume in 1 second (FEV-1), and maximal expiratory flow rates (MEF50%FVC, MEF25%FVC).
- Logistic regression used to calculate odds ratios (OR) for dementia, adjusting for age, gender, education, ApoE4 status, COPD, smoking, heart failure, sensory function, grip strength, and physical activity.
Main Results:
- Significantly increased odds of dementia were observed in participants with the lowest ventilatory capacity compared to the best-functioning group.
- Odds ratios for dementia were elevated across all measured ventilatory capacity indicators: PEF-R (OR=20.4), FEV-1 (OR=7.5), MEF50%FVC (OR=4.3), and MEF25%FVC (OR=4.7).
Conclusions:
- Ventilatory capacity, assessed by spirometry, shows a cross-sectional association with dementia in a representative sample of the very elderly.
- Findings suggest that diminished respiratory function may be an independent risk factor for dementia, even after accounting for known risk factors.
